计算机原理:8086微处理器与三态缓冲器
需积分: 3 141 浏览量
更新于2024-08-21
收藏 1.57MB PPT 举报
"该资源是一份关于计算机原理的讲义,由李卓函教授在电信学部控制科学与工程学院讲授。主要内容涵盖微型计算机概述、16位微处理器8086、指令系统、汇编语言程序设计、存储器、输入/输出接口设计、中断系统、可编程接口芯片、AD/DA转换和串行通信等。课程还强调了如何学习计算机原理,并给出了期末成绩的计算方式。参考教材包括《微型计算机技术及应用》、《IBM-PC汇编语言程序设计》和《16/32位微机原理、汇编语言及接口技术》。此外,课程涉及到三态缓冲器的概念,它在OE为低电平时,输出F与输入A相同;OE为高电平时,输出F浮空,允许其他器件输出。"
在计算机硬件中,三态缓冲器是一种重要的电路组件,尤其在总线系统中起到关键作用。三态缓冲器通常包含一个三态门,其特点是可以根据控制信号OE(Output Enable)来控制其输出状态。当OE为低电平时,三态门被激活,其输出F与输入A保持一致,即F=A。这意味着三态缓冲器可以作为一个简单的信号复制器,将输入信号无损地传送到输出端。然而,当OE为高电平时,三态门的输出进入“高阻抗”状态,也称为浮空状态,此时输出F不连接到任何电路,允许其他设备接管总线并输出自己的信号。
在微机系统中,总线是连接不同硬件组件的通信线路,包括地址总线、数据总线和控制总线。地址总线用于传输内存地址,决定CPU可以直接访问的内存大小;数据总线则负责在CPU和其他设备之间传输数据,可以双向传输;而控制总线用于发送控制信号,协调总线操作。三态缓冲器常被用作总线驱动器,根据需要切换到输入或高阻抗状态,确保总线在多个设备间正确且高效地共享。
学习计算机原理,不仅需要理解这些基本的硬件概念,还需要掌握微处理器的工作原理、指令系统、汇编语言编程以及接口技术。这有助于深入理解计算机系统的运行机制,为后续的软件开发、系统设计和故障排查奠定基础。通过阅读指定的教材和参与课程讨论,学生能够系统性地学习这些知识,并通过期末考试、期中考试和平时成绩综合评价来检验学习效果。
2020-07-21 上传
2023-05-27 上传
2023-05-27 上传
2023-05-22 上传
2023-12-07 上传
2023-07-20 上传
2024-02-29 上传
2023-06-12 上传
2024-10-03 上传
速本
- 粉丝: 20
- 资源: 2万+
最新资源
- 彩虹rain bow point鼠标指针压缩包使用指南
- C#开发的C++作业自动批改系统
- Java实战项目:城市公交查询系统及部署教程
- 深入掌握Spring Boot基础技巧与实践
- 基于SSM+Mysql的校园通讯录信息管理系统毕业设计源码
- 精选简历模板分享:简约大气,适用于应届生与在校生
- 个性化Windows桌面:自制图标大全指南
- 51单片机超声波测距项目源码解析
- 掌握SpringBoot实战:深度学习笔记解析
- 掌握Java基础语法的关键知识点
- SSM+mysql邮件管理系统毕业设计源码免费下载
- wkhtmltox下载困难?找到正确的安装包攻略
- Python全栈开发项目资源包 - 功能复刻与开发支持
- 即时消息分发系统架构设计:以tio为基础
- 基于SSM框架和MySQL的在线书城项目源码
- 认知OFDM技术在802.11标准中的项目实践